Compared to plants from other environments, the cells of many desert plants contain high concentrations of solutes. This helps t

hem survive in their arid surroundings because the high solute concentrations create relatively:__________

Answer:

Low Solute potential

Explanation:

A solute potential is the potential of water to move from a solution that where the concentration of the solutes is higher on the inside to the solution where the concentration of the solutes is higher on the outside.

Solute potential is also known as osmotic potential. It is the applied pressure that is required to hinder the water from flowing inside across a semi permeable membrane.

The reason plants in the desert survive their arid conditions because they tend to retain the concentration of water in them, they have waxy cuticles or tough skin which prevent evaporation of water from the plants, there by creating in a high concentration of solutes in such plants which results in a low solute potential.

Some molecules found in foods are known to be capable of driving DNA methylation or DNA demethylation. For example, folic acid (
Rufina [12.5K]

Answer: Eating excessive quantities of such molecules could deregulate this process, increasing methylation and repressing the expression of genes that should normally be expressed.

Explanation:

DNA methylation is one of the epigenetic mechanisms involved in the regulation of gene expression, because it is a process by which methyl groups are added to DNA.

Methylation then modifies the function of DNA when it is found in the promoter gene, it is essential for normal development and is associated with a number of key processes, including genomic imprinting, inactivation of the X chromosome, repression of repeating elements, aging, and carcinogenesis. Usually, <u>it acts to suppress gene transcription.</u>

For example, folic acid is essential for the rapid cell division that occurs during early fetal development and it also plays an important role in methylation and thus in gene regulation. <u>The metabolism of these vitamins is aimed at achieving adequate levels of  DNA methylation, necessary for the cellular processes</u>. Eating excessive quantities of such molecules could deregulate this process, <u>increasing methylation and repressing the expression of genes that should normally be expressed</u>.
